Muhammad Wilkerson
Height: 6’4
Weight: 315
College: Temple
40 Time: 4.96
Class: Junior
Stock:
Projected: 1st-2nd Round
Stats
2010 – 70 tackles, 13.0 TFL, 9.0 sacks
2009 – 61 tackles, 10.5 TFL, 6.5 sacks
2008 – 13 tackles, 2.5 TFL, 1.0 sack
Overview:
Muhammad Wilkerson is getting some solid 1st round consideration and I’d say it’s well deserved. He has the potential to be a great 3-4 end because of his size and strength. He can occupy blockers and is tough player. He has to work on his technique, most notably his hand usage. He still struggles to shed blocks at times although he does have the ability. He may need some work but he can be a good player in the NFL.
Scouting Report:
Positives
- Impressive size
- Good quickness off the snap
- Very strong
- Anchors really well
- Powerful bull-rush
- Flashes a nice swim move
- Does a good job against double teams
- Very disruptive inside
- Can penetrate but also take up multiple blockers
- Has violent hands
- Plays with a lot of toughness and has a good motor
- Versatile, played everywhere on the D-Line
- Can play DT in the 4-3 or DE in the 3-4
- Has a lot of potential
Negatives
- Doesn’t have many pass-rush moves
- If the bull-rush is stopped he won’t get anywhere
- Has to use his hands better to get off of blocks
- Gets too high out of his stance at times
- Can be too aggressive and over-run plays
- Needs to polish up his technique
- Didn’t face the greatest competition
